Minimalist Wardrobe Actions

Transformational action is at the heart of these effective wardrobe minimalism tips from Indonesian stylists. Start by:

  • Identifying Core Needs: Determine which clothing items are indispensable in your daily life.
  • Embracing Versatility: Choose pieces that can be mixed and matched easily.
  • Prioritizing Quality: Invest in high-quality materials and timeless designs.
  • Clearing Clutter: Remove items no longer useful or worn frequently.
  • Analyzing Lifestyle Needs: Tailor your wardrobe to suit your current lifestyle.
  • Integrating Colors: Stick with a cohesive color palette.
  • Recognizing Sentimental Pieces: Keep items with deep personal significance.
  • Utilizing Space Efficiently: Arrange your wardrobe for easy access.
  • Engaging Professional Stylist Services: Consult with stylists for personalized advice.
  • Refreshing Regularly: Regularly evaluate and update your closet per seasonal changes.
